Firmware 186 and App 199 are now available for the following devices:
  • Control X4
  • Control X2
  • Control XS
  • WaveEngine
  • IceCap WiFi Controller
Firmware 186 is now the public release version

IMPORTANT: Firmware 186 requires App 199. To update to firmware 186, you must download App 199 first. If you are using the web app, please clear your browser's cache so it updates to the new app as well.

NEVER, EVER, EVER update your firmware if you are not in the same location as your controller.

As always, you can also control your devices using our CoralVue HYDROS Web App. (Be sure to clear your browser's cache and refresh so that the app updates to the latest version.)

BEFORE
you do that, please do read the following:
  1. Once you update the firmware and upload, you CANNOT downgrade the unit or revert to the old firmware.
  2. The update will automatically update the WaveEngine to match the way the control works.
    1. Pumps are treated as OUTPUTS. To add a pump, you go to OUTPUTS and add the pump to add a simple pump on the Control.
    2. PRESETS and TRIGGERS are now combined into SCHEDULES. The schedule will allow you to select a flow pattern, give it a schedule, and assign pumps to it the same way you assign INPUTS on a GENERIC OUTPUT.
    3. You can now run scheduled on certain days of the week.
    4. You can also now run schedules based on the Nth day.
    5. You can assign pump positions on the schedules so you can have one pump be "Same Side" on A schedule while "Opposite Side" on schedule B.
    6. You can now assign pump direction on the schedule, so if you want to run Pump A only in reverse for a couple of hours, you can do that now!
UPGRADING SINGLE DEVICES (NON-COLLECTIVE)

To update the WaveEngine to the new firmware:
  1. Head over to the download firmware screen and tap on "Download 186."
  2. Tap on the "Install 186" button and wait for your WaveEngine to restart.
  3. After restarting, connect to the WaveEngine and go to the STATUS screen. IT WILL BE EMPTY! Tap on the "Upload Required" orange bar at the bottom. This will "convert" all your settings from the old flow to the new one.
ADDING THE WAVEENGINE TO THE COLLECTIVE

You can now bring your WE into the collective, but before you do that, please know the following:
  1. You must be running app 199 or greater.
  2. Your WaveEngine must be running firmware 186
  3. The WaveEngine CANNOT be a Collective WiFi Master, so set the WaveEngine to NEVER.
  4. When you bring your WaveEngine into an EXISTING collective, the WaveEngine will be imported EMPTY!!!! This means that you will need to program it again within the collective when you bring the WE into the collective. Unfortunately, there is no way around this, and it is in line with any devices brought into an EXISTING collective.
To bring the WaveEngine into your collective:
  1. Connect to your Collective and make sure you can see your STATUS
  2. Tap on the upper-left-hand-corner hamburger menu and then select "Devices."
  3. Tap on the + symbol at the bottom of the page
  4. Select your WaveEngine
  5. IMPORTANT: Set the WiFi Priority to "Never"
  6. Upload your changes
Once your WaveEngine is part of the collective, it will restart, and then, the LEDs will change to the same color as the Control units. Notice the green LED at the top of the unit letting you know the WE is now part of a collective.

Once your WaveEngine is part of the collective, it will restart, and then, the LEDs will change to the same color as the Control units. Notice the green LED at the top of the unit letting you know the WE is now part of a collective.

waveengine-1.png

If you see a white LED at the bottom of your WE, that means that you have a WE-ETM version!

waveengine-bottom-white.png


!!!! --- WaveEngine/IceCap Controller Warning --- !!!!
  1. Your old configurations will be automatically imported to the new Outputs/Schedule format. That being said, YOU SHOULD STILL DOUBLE CHECK SETTINGS to make sure things were properly imported.
  2. Once you update your WE/IceCap Controller to the new firmware, you MUST upload your changes. There is an orange bar telling you "Updates Required" so please, upload the changes when you see that orange bar! If you do not upload the changes, then the migration will not be completed!
  3. If you add your WE to your collective, ALL settings on your WE will be lost. Settings ARE NOT imported to a collective. Make sure to write these down before adding to a collective.

!!!! --- HYDROS Control Warning --- !!!!
  1. Water Sensor / Skimmer Sensor INPUTS - We added the ability to trigger an alarm when the sensors are WET or DRY. If you have a sensor created, please make sure that the alarm will trigger in the correct state for your setup.
  2. Collectives and Button Boxes - You must go into the OPTIONS menu and reselect the "Mode Control Input" so it is set to the correct device where your button box is connected to. Once done, upload your changes!


Changelog for Monday, May 24, 2021:
  • [FIXED] - Purple reset did not wipe configuration from SD card
  • [FIXED] - 0-10V INPUT showed red tile when open. Now user can select inside or outside the range for alarm trigger.
  • [FIXED] - Repeating schedule not following run count limits
  • [FIXED] - Various visual bugs on labels
  • [FIXED] - Default notification interval is now 1 hour
  • Added cloud backup ability to the WaveEngine and IceCap Controller
  • [FIXED] - On 0-10V INPUT Switch, wording changes from "Active when" to "Wet when."
  • [FIXED] - Multiple issues with WaveEngine migration software
  • Added ability to specify "Low Power" mode on Options screen
  • [FIXED] - When using 0-10V as OUTPUT, now you have the ability to set voltage range
  • Added notification option to water sensors and 0-10V INPUTS
  • [FIXED] - Variable output showing the incorrect minimum intensity when OFF
  • [FIXED] - Uploads were very slow on larger collectives
  • Added Push Notifications to HYDROS system
  • Removed option for SMS notifications
  • [FIXED] - Issue where customers registering their first product would get a "Bad Gateway" error
  • [FIXED] - System triggers an alarm immediately if INPUT is missing due to reboot. Added a slight delay to prevent this from happening.
  • [FIXED] - When using Button INPUT on Generic OUTPUT, both high and low thresholds were showing
  • [FIXED] - Flow Pump Outputs would show on the Mode setup page
  • [FIXED] - Issue where Direct Drive OUTPUT would report incorrect power consumption
  • [FIXED] - Manual Single Feedings with the Feeder were not very responsive
  • [FIXED] - On Feeder output, users could select outputs other than a Feeder WiFi Device
  • [FIXED] - OUTPUT showed Mismatch when caught in between hysteresis. When in between the Range, ON/OFF depends on where the OUTPUT reading is coming from
  • [FIXED] - Issue where 0-10V INPUTS did not graph
  • [FIXED] - When creating a schedule, the pattern defaulted to "Constant." Now it defaults to none
  • [FIXED] - On WaveEngine tiles, speed was being pushed off the tile
  • Added running "Schedule" on flow pump override popup window
  • [FIXED] - Fish Feeder WiFi device setup page was not reporting the "used by" field correctly
  • [FIXED] - "Create Collective" button was pushed off the screen when the user sets the mobile default font to large
  • [FIXED] - Purging old, deleted INPUTS and OUTPUTS from the JSON file
  • Added ability to select All/None INPUTS and OUTPUT when arranging pages
  • Added Dual TDS Sensor compatibility
  • [FIXED] - Change wording under HYDROS Device description from "Internal Temp" to "PC Board Temp."
  • [FIXED] - User was able to hide all tiles/text in a status section
  • Added Terms of Agreement to the app when first opened. Sorry... our lawyers made us do it
  • [FIXED] - When coming out of a Mode where the feeder was not active, the feeder would rotate once
  • [FIXED] - Alkatronic tile did not turn red when reading was out of range
  • Added JSON compression to help with large collectives and speed up the upload process
  • [FIXED] - Issue where if you were looking at your system from two different applications, one device would go blank
  • Changed Bluetooth accessibility to "Read ONLY." You can override outputs, but you cannot make configuration changes anymore. In collective settings, you must connect to the Collective WiFi master to override outputs.
  • [FIXED] - Issue wherein a collective of multiple devices, you could not specify the exact device where the 0-10V button box was connected to in the options page under "Mode Control Input."
  • [FIXED] - Unable to turn ON Kalk reactor stirrer manually. Both output tiles would turn on the reactor pump.
  • [FIXED] - Converted Notification Interval to dropdown and no longer allows customers to set time to 0.
  • [FIXED] - Fixed issue when trying to restore from cloud backup, and the app would not uncompress the file before reading it.
  • [FIXED] - Issue where if there were only one input or output, a gray box would display instead of in the status screen
  • On collectives, you can no longer remove the last device. Instead, we require you to remove the collective to ensure customers do not end up with empty collectives.
  • [FIXED] - After creating a collective, a second reboot was required to access the status screen.
  • Customers cannot create empty collectives anymore.
  • Customers cannot create a collective with a WaveEngine.
  • [FIXED] - On large collectives, it would take several attempts to upload a configuration change to all devices.
  • [FIXED] - Issue with TDS meter showing red even though the sensor was connected to the unit.
  • [FIXED] - Issue when upgrading WE firmware on large collectives
  • Added RODI preset
  • Implemented new code to make the collective more reliable during firmware updates
  • [FIXED] - Many issues with IceCap Controller
  • Added constant refresh to IceCap Controller
  • [FIXED] - Issue in the collective, where having ETM enabled would always prompt an update even if there were no changes
  • Optimized uploads in collective and WaveEngine to make them faster on larger collectives
  • [FIXED] - Multiple small bugs
  • [FIXED] - Correct video is shown when pairing a WiFi Feeder
  • [FIXED] - Size rendering is now fixed as we are using a new rendering engine that ensures that everything looks the same on all platforms (iOS, Android, Windows, Mac)
  • Added "Pages" with cross-platform support
  • Added ability to reorder tiles, graphs, and text with cross-platform support
  • Renamed HYDROS devices to reflect the new official names instead of internal names
  • Bluetooth access is now Read-Only. One can still override outputs but can no longer make configuration changes in Bluetooth mode.
  • Extended the ORP range to include negative numbers and accommodate nitrate reactors.

Ok, the issue why you are having problems downloading the firmware is because you have a collective of 1. That is something that is an overkill since a collective is only for more than one devices. On the old version of the app we do warn you not to create a collective of one and on the new app, it is something we do not allow.

In this case, we will need to destroy your collective, then restore your settings into the individual device, and then update the settings. Once you remove the device from a collective of one, you will be able to update without any problems.
